Transaction 528af64178c1385ddc4b177a9f6e52439efab8ad371e9ae7f780967341019e7e

7 Input
2 Outputs
  • 528af64178c1385ddc4b177a9f6e52439efab8ad371e9ae7f780967341019e7e:0
  • value  30000000
    address  1Eqg14zadVjgrJF7YbuimMrHLkTuTFW8TU
  • 528af64178c1385ddc4b177a9f6e52439efab8ad371e9ae7f780967341019e7e:1
  • value  1318409
    address  186WQQggdX2oJkw5DvyMMbAxQmJHzTUm4B